WebbProbability:Probability theory is a branch of pure mathematics, and forms the theoretical basis of statistics. In itself, probability theory has some basic objects and their relations (like real num- bers, addition etc for analysis) and it makes no pretense of saying anything about the real world. WebbIProbability reasons about a sample, knowing the population. IThe goal of statistics is to estimate the population based on a sample.
